Runbook: GarageGlance occupancy feed

If the Harborview Deck occupancy feed goes stale (no updates for 5+ minutes), first check the sensor gateway health page. Green but stale usually means the aggregator queue is backed up; restart the aggregator via the ops console and counts should recover within two minutes. If spots show negative numbers, force a full recount from the camera snapshots. When escalating to engineering, include the trace token shown below.

session token of yawif-kahof = htk9_dd6996ed6

Webhook retry semantics — Corvette Dispatch. Failed deliveries retry with exponential backoff: 30s, 2m, 10m, 1h, then dead-letter after five attempts. A 2xx stops retries. 410 disables the endpoint permanently — do not re-enable without partner sign-off. Retries are idempotent; consumers must dedupe on event ID. During release freeze, drain the dead-letter queue before cutting the tag, or stale events replay against new schema. Check queue depth in the Dispatch console before approving. Verify against the token below.

session token of bawep-yadup = htk21_528abd376e3c5a4ec24a1

Subject: Quickstore 4.2 — bloom filter now fronts the KV layer

Plugin authors: starting with this release, Quickstore places a bloom filter ahead of the key-value store. Negative lookups return faster; false positives fall through safely. No API changes are required on your side. Verify your plugin against the staging build referenced below.

session token of fahif-tadup = htk3_9c7

Before keys are generated, confirm the Grindstone analyzer baseline file for release 9.1 is frozen and checksummed. The baseline suppresses 212 known findings; any delta from the recorded hash invalidates the ceremony and requires a restart. Release manager compares the hash read aloud by the custodian against the printed manifest, then initials both copies. The frozen baseline is stored in the sealed ceremony archive. Opening that archive at a later date requires the recovery passphrase noted below.

unlock words, yagep-fahof: belix-rusvan-casdor-gorox-aldath-norael-istix-quenael-fraeth-silael